首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

React/Redux -编辑列表项后不更新列表

React/Redux是一种流行的JavaScript库和其衍生的状态管理工具,用于构建用户界面和管理应用程序的状态。当在编辑列表项后,列表没有更新,可能是因为以下原因:

  1. 数据未正确更新:在React/Redux中,数据流是单向的,数据的改变需要通过触发action来更新store中的状态,然后再重新渲染组件。如果在编辑列表项后,没有正确更新相应的数据,那么列表就不会更新。可以检查是否正确触发了相应的action,以及更新了对应的state。
  2. 组件没有正确订阅状态:在React/Redux中,组件通过connect函数来连接到store,订阅状态的更新。如果在编辑列表项后,组件没有正确订阅相关的状态,那么即使状态更新了,组件也不会重新渲染。可以检查是否正确使用了connect函数,并且传递了正确的state到组件。
  3. 组件没有正确使用更新后的props:在React中,组件通过props来接收数据并进行渲染。如果在编辑列表项后,组件没有正确使用更新后的props,那么列表就不会更新。可以检查组件是否正确使用了更新后的props,并且进行了重新渲染。
  4. Redux中间件问题:Redux中间件可以在action被派发到reducer之前进行一些额外的处理。如果使用了一些自定义的中间件,可能会影响数据的更新,导致编辑列表项后列表不更新。可以检查是否使用了中间件,并且确保其正常工作。

针对这个问题,腾讯云提供了一系列相关产品和服务,可以帮助开发者构建高效、可靠的应用程序。例如,可以使用腾讯云的云函数SCF作为后端逻辑来处理数据的更新和响应。此外,腾讯云还提供了云数据库CDB、云存储COS等产品,用于存储和管理应用程序的数据。具体产品介绍和使用方法可以参考腾讯云的官方文档和链接:

  • 腾讯云函数SCF:https://cloud.tencent.com/product/scf
  • 腾讯云数据库CDB:https://cloud.tencent.com/product/cdb
  • 腾讯云对象存储COS:https://cloud.tencent.com/product/cos
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券